Web1 feb. 2024 · Beef Brisket has a more rectangular shape, while Chuck Roast has a rounded shape. Beef Brisket has a higher fat content, making it more flavorful, while Chuck Roast has a lower fat content, making it a healthier option. Beef Brisket takes up to 10 hours to cook, while Chuck Roast takes 2-3 hours. Web3 jul. 2024 · The breast or pectoral muscles of cattle carry about 60% of their weight, so it’s no surprise that brisket has a lot of connective tissue running through the meat. Brisket is ideal for low-and-slow cooking methods that give this connective tissue time to convert into delicious gelatin.
